I am new to gtk prog. and am facing a few problems. It would be great if
someone could clarify the following doubts for me :
a) How do I pass two or more parameters to a call back function.
b) Call back functions of which signals/events accept how many
parameters? Is this fixed? Where can I find more help on this?
c) While using ItemFactory to make a menubar, how do I send user
parameters to the callback functions? Also, how do I take care of the
value returned by the functions (Is this possible???)
d) While using ItemFactory to make menus, what is the function
definition of the callback function? I tried to look in sample programs,
and found different formats of the function definition in different
places. They all seem to work...
As you can see, I am basically having trouble understanding the theory
behind callback functions.
